hauling camper

we have a scout aliner. my wife can not raise it by herself.
any problems towing with camper already popped up??

  • When the Aliner is folded, the box adds more rigidity to the sides of the unit. The cutout for the door considerably weakens the structure so with the roof not closed there would be considerable flexing of the box going over bumps. I actually added an additional hold-down clamp between the roof and door side of my Aliner so as to further reduce any flexing when towing.

    I might move my Aliner with the roof up in my back yard or very slowly at a cg but never would go down the road that way.
  • Everything I can find says, "No!" Aliner even sells a high wind kit to reinforce the top against high winds while deployed for camping. That wouldn't be necessary if it would stand up to highway speed winds.
